6.

Melinda 有三个空盒子和 1212 本课本,其中三本是数学课本。一个盒子能装任意三本课本,一个能装任意四本课本,一个能装任意五本课本。若 Melinda 按随机顺序把课本装进这些盒子,所有三本数学课本都在同一个盒子里的概率可写成 mn\frac{m}{n},其中 mmnn 是互质正整数。求 m+nm + n

Melinda has three empty boxes and 1212 textbooks, three of which are mathematics textbooks. One box will hold any three of her textbooks, one will hold any four of her textbooks, and one will hold any five of her textbooks. If Melinda packs her textbooks into these boxes in random order, the probability that all three mathematics textbooks end up in the same box can be written as mn,\frac{m}{n}, where mm and nn are relatively prime positive integers. Find m+n.m + n.

答案:47

解答:

一次只看一个盒子。装 kk 本书的盒子得到 1212 本书中的一个等可能的 kk 元子集,因此它含有全部三本数学书的概率为 (9k3)/(12k)\binom{9}{k-3}\big/\binom{12}{k}。当 k=3,4,5k = 3, 4, 5 时,分别为 1220\frac{1}{220}9495=155\frac{9}{495} = \frac{1}{55}36792=122\frac{36}{792} = \frac{1}{22}

这些事件互不相交,所以总概率为 因此 m+n=3+44=47m + n = 3 + 44 = 471220+155+122=1+4+10220=15220=344, \begin{aligned} \frac{1}{220} + \frac{1}{55} + \frac{1}{22} &= \frac{1 + 4 + 10}{220} \\ &= \frac{15}{220} = \frac{3}{44}, \end{aligned}

Focus on one box at a time. The box of kk books receives a uniformly random kk-subset of the 1212 books, so the probability that it contains all three math books is (9k3)/(12k).\binom{9}{k-3}\big/\binom{12}{k}. For k=3,4,5k = 3, 4, 5 this gives 1220,\frac{1}{220}, 9495=155,\frac{9}{495} = \frac{1}{55}, and 36792=122.\frac{36}{792} = \frac{1}{22}.

The events are disjoint, so the total probability is 1220+155+122=1+4+10220=15220=344, \begin{aligned} \frac{1}{220} + \frac{1}{55} + \frac{1}{22} &= \frac{1 + 4 + 10}{220} \\ &= \frac{15}{220} = \frac{3}{44}, \end{aligned} and m+n=3+44=47.m + n = 3 + 44 = 47.
